Output 124d1c050a8db7f658ac6922a29acf4e5d12f933f63d8ecc5b962131c509b606:8

value
70398763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5ba48c81286be7a33352d2a6f237f2801b89c5a OP_EQUAL
address
MP1StLpMkcch78y58cTHN2WVrP1C9eaWAT
transaction
124d1c050a8db7f658ac6922a29acf4e5d12f933f63d8ecc5b962131c509b606
spent
true